Navigating the Perils of Deep Space

At the heart of most astronaut games lies the challenge of piloting a spacecraft and managing resources in the unforgiving vacuum of space. Players often begin with limited supplies – oxygen, fuel, and food – and are tasked with collecting more as they journey further from home. Resource management isn’t merely a posturing feature but a critical element that directly affects the astronaut’s well-being and the viability of the ongoing mission. Maintaining Astronaut Health and Wellbeing

The health of the astronaut is paramount in these games. Prolonged exposure to the harsh conditions of space, coupled with the stresses of isolation, can take a toll. Games like incorporate realistic health systems that monitor factors such as oxygen levels, food intake, and even psychological well-being. Maintaining optimal health often involves completing specific tasks – performing regular exercise, interacting with the ship’s AI to combat loneliness, and carefully managing food and water rations. Failing to attend to these issues can lead to detrimental effects on performance, ultimately endangering the overall success of the objectives.
